TAJYIRE launches robotics and skills ecosystem to boost Rwanda’s digital transformation
By Elias Hakizimana.
TAJYIRE Group Holdings Ltd has on June 25, 2026, launched three interconnected innovation initiatives aimed at strengthening Rwanda’s digital skills development, expanding STEM education, and linking learning to employment opportunities within a growing technology ecosystem.
The initiatives, unveiled under the theme “Building Rwanda’s Digital Future,” include the TAJYIRE Robotic System for School Learners, the TecBridge Program, and the TAJYIRE Distribution Engine (TDE). Together, they are designed to create a pathway that connects education, innovation, and market access for young people.
The launch brought together representatives from the Rwanda TVET Board (RTB), the Ministry of ICT and Innovation (MINICT), educators, and private sector stakeholders.

RTB backs stronger industry–education collaboration
Speaking at the event, RTB officials welcomed the initiative, saying it strengthens the link between technical education and industry.
Emmanuel Asher Mutijima, Digital Technologies Division Manager at RTB, said TAJYIRE provides a practical platform where learners can gain real-world experience.
“TAJYIRE is a strong example of how technical education can be connected to industry needs. It provides internships, industrial attachments, and pathways into employment,” he said.
He added that discussions are ongoing between RTB and TAJYIRE on accreditation of training programs to ensure learners receive recognized certification.

TAJYIRE founder and CEO Lambert Gahungu said the initiative reflects the company’s goal of building an integrated ecosystem that combines training, innovation, and market access.
He said the organization operates a structure that includes a marketplace, training center, and research and development unit, all working together.
“We are building an ecosystem that connects training, innovation, and the market so that skills can directly translate into opportunities,” he said.
Gahungu noted that more than 1,300 technicians and electronics traders are already part of TAJYIRE’s ecosystem in Kigali.
He added that the model will be expanded to secondary cities across Rwanda to widen access to technical training and innovation opportunities.

Three initiatives designed to build future-ready skills
The three initiatives launched include a robotics education program for learners, a scholarship-based training initiative for underserved youth, and an integrated distribution system linking production, training, and market access.
The robotics system introduces students to coding and engineering through practical learning using modular kits and structured progression from basic to advanced programming.
The TecBridge Program focuses on digital skills, electronics, and entrepreneurship training, targeting young people with limited access to formal technical education.
The Distribution Engine (TDE) connects suppliers, manufacturers, training centers, and distributors into a unified system aimed at improving efficiency and scaling innovation.
Gahungu also emphasized the need for Africa to move from consuming technology to producing it.

“These technologies are already shaping the world. The question is whether we will produce or only consume them,” he said, calling for stronger collaboration between government, academia, and the private sector.
Representing the Ministry of ICT and Innovation, Erneste Mpundu from the Digital Inclusion Council said the initiative aligns with Rwanda’s digital transformation goals.
He said the country is experiencing rising demand for digital skills, especially with the growth of artificial intelligence and emerging technologies.
“It is encouraging to see youth-led initiatives focusing on skills development and job creation. Rwanda needs innovators who can both use and create technology,” he said.

Students welcome hands-on learning opportunities
Students who visited the TAJYIRE center said it helped bridge the gap between theory and practice in technical education.
A Senior Five student in Electronics and Telecommunications, Shema Alain, said lack of equipment has often limited practical learning in schools.
“What I saw at TAJYIRE is impressive. This platform can really help TVET students,” he said, calling for more investment in practical training opportunities.
Another student, Nirere Husna, said the center helped her better understand classroom lessons through hands-on experience and urged expansion of similar centers across the country.
